After several years in development and an extensive early access phase, Nacon and crea-ture Studios have set the exact date when Session: Skate Sim will no longer be available in early access to make way for its definitive version, something what will happen from September 22.
It was originally published for PC on Steam in September 2019 and a few months later it headed for Xbox One. However, its launch will take place on more platforms, so that in September it can also be purchased on PS5, Xbox Series X / S and through the Epic Games Store in the case of its PC version.
The gameplay of this title is characterized by the fact that each of the control sticks represents one of the feet of our character. This guarantees a very realistic experience by having to learn to control the weight that is deposited with each one, with physics that focus on fluidity and a deep immersion.
In addition to having several game modes, the best way to show off your best tricks is to record it. For this, it has a camera that will follow us at all times to later edit and create clips that can be shared with the rest of the world, but it will also have filters and effects to give the result a more spectacular and unique touch.
